Frequently Asked Questions
How much does a 385W Waaree Solar WS 385W B Plus cost?
The Waaree Solar WS 385W B Plus costs approximately $678 per panel ($$1.76/W). A typical 7kW system using this panel would cost around $12,320 before incentives. After the 30% federal tax credit, your net cost drops to $8,624.
Is the Waaree Solar WS 385W B Plus a good solar panel?
The Waaree Solar WS 385W B Plus has 18.9% efficiency and a 12 years warranty, placing it in the standard tier. This is a solid mid-range panel suitable for most residential installations.
How many Waaree Solar WS 385W B Plus panels do I need?
For a typical 7kW residential system, you'd need approximately 19 panels. For a 10kW system, plan for about 26 panels. The exact number depends on your roof space, energy usage, and local sun hours.
